Walter

The name Walter has a history based in Old German. It is derived from the German name Waldhere, with "wald" meaning "rule" and "hari" meaning "army." This can be translated to mean "powerful ruler" or "warrior."

Similar Names: Wally, Walt
Famous Walter Names: Walter Matthau (actor), Walter Cronkite (broadcast journalist)
